WHEELS - CAP/COVER/HUB
07E106000FEDERAL-MOGUL CORPORATION E (Equipment)13000002/07/2008MFRGENERAL MOTORS CORP.12/17/200712/19/2007
Defect SummaryCertain federal-mogul replacement wheel hub assemblies with the brand names: national, carquest p/nos. 515020, 515021, 515025, 515053, 515054, 515059, and 515060, shipped between january 23, 2006, and december 20, 2007, sold for light duty and medium duty trucks. the inboard retention nut used to maintain hub bearing assembly can loosen resulting in an abs light indication, noise, and/or wheel separation.
Consequence SummaryWheel separation can result in a vehicle crash.
Corrective SummaryFederal-mogul will notify customers and will replace the hub assembly free of charge. the recall began on february 7, 2008. owners can contact federal-mogul toll-free at 877-489-6659.
NotesThis recall only pertains to replacement national, carquest wheel hub assemblies and has no relation to any original equipment installed on vehicles manufactured by general motors or ford.customers may contact the national highway traffic safety administration's vehicle safety hotline at 1-888-327-4236 (tty: 1-800-424-9153); or go to http://www.safercar.gov.

 Abs light came on along with a loud hum and rattling from front tire area. had to get the hub assembly replace. this happened around 90,000 miles with the front passenger side tire, and around 130,000 miles with the front driver side tire. both mechanics i brought it to said this was a commoon problem for my type of vehicle. they also mentioned that when this occurs the entire wheel could fall off and result in a major accident if traveling at high speeds.

 Tl*the contact owns a 2004 chevrolet tahoe. the contact stated while driving approximately 75 mph she heard a clicking noise followed by the illumination of the anti-lock brake and fuel gauge warning lights on the instrument panel. moments later the vehicle stalled. upon restart the vehicle operated as normal. the failure recurred approximately twenty times within a two week period. the vehicle was taken to an independent mechanic where they were unable to diagnose the failure. the contact planned on taking the vehicle to an authorized dealer to have the failure diagnosed. the contact also expressed concern of nhtsa campaign id numbers: 04v045000 (fuel system, gasoline), 04v045000 (service brakes, hydraulic) and 07e106000 (wheels: cap/cover/hub, which he believed could have possibly contributed to the failure. the vin was not included in any of the recalls and the vehicle was not repaired. the manufacturer was not made aware of the failure. the failure mileage was 140,000.
